HDR is seeking a driven, hands-on marketing intern to assist with business development, marketing, and strategic efforts for HDR's Colorado Area. Working in a cross-functional environment, the marketing intern is responsible for supporting our marketing and strategic program activities. This includes working with marketers, project managers and technical staff to develop project descriptions, resumes, proposals, presentations, brochures, and other marketing materials. These efforts require a significant amount of independent research, collaboration, technical writing, and creative thinking. Strong organizational, writing/composition, and people skills are essential, along with the ability to work under deadlines with diplomacy. This position will require balancing multiple priorities and the ability to handle multiple concurrent assignments while maintaining quality.


In the role of Marketing Intern, we'll count on you to:



  • Work collaboratively with marketing team to support marketing initiatives.
  • Shadow and assist marketing staff with the preparation of materials, including proposals, presentations, brochures, award submittals, and announcements
  • Develop, review, and edit content for resumes, project descriptions, and other marketing material
  • Develop and coordinate text and graphics and edit page layouts
  • Implement the company's brand strategy
  • Maintain the CRM system and perform other data-driven tasks
  • Catalogue marketing assets
  • Perform other duties as needed
